DCP Broad Plate

Broad Dynamic Compression Plate are indicated for fixation of various long bones, such as the humerus, femur and tibia. It is particularly used as a tension band plates for femoral fractures. These are also used in fixation of peri-prosthetic fractures, osteopenic bone and fixation of non-unions and malunions in adult patients.

The DCP hole is designed to create dynamic pressure between the fractured bone fragments.

All holes of the plate allow 4.5 mm cortical screws, If located over cancellous bone Ø 6.5 mm cancellous screw can be inserted in the end hole

Use broad plates with six or seven holes in exceptional cases only, e.g. on the humerus.

Plates available with 4,5,6,7,8,9,10,11,12,13,14,15,16,17, & 18 holes.

Screw to be used: Fixation with Ø 4.5 mm cortical screws and Ø6.5 mm. end holes are also suitable for cancellous screws.

Plate profile 16.2 mm. x 5 mm.
Plate thickness: 5.0 mm.
Plate width: 16.2 mm.
Holes Spacing: 16.0 and 25.0 mm.

Indications: As a tension band plate on the femur and for humeral pseudoarthrosis (not intended for the tibia).
